Abstract
Nitride based coatings claimed a big market share for PVD-coatings. Especially in the field for high temperature die casting and cutting operations chromium based coatings are well used. These coatings are also used in low temperature processes for the coating of machine parts. In the beginning of the nineties first examinations are done on the ternary system Chromium-Aluminium- Nitride. This system shows an excellent corrosion behaviour against many different liquids, but gains also a high hardness for a good wear behaviour. By changing the AlN to CrN content and the coating design CrAlN opens up a wide range for different coating applications. A major step for machine parts was the reducing of coating process temperature beneath 200°C. This was only possible by using pulsed power supplies. CrAlN shows a very good performance on the fast growing market of coated machine parts e.g. on spindle bearings. © 2006 WILEY-VCH Verlag GmbH & Co. KGaA.
